Imports In 2022, Comoros imported $80.5k in Glues, becoming the 201st largest importer of Glues in the world. At the same year, Glues was the 296th most imported product in Comoros. Comoros imports Glues primarily from: United Arab Emirates ($49.9k), China ($27.7k), France ($2.73k), and Turkey ($147).

The fastest growing import markets in Glues for Comoros between 2021 and 2022 were United Arab Emirates ($13.9k) and France ($2.57k).
